ADP February Jobs Report ?3
08:51 04-Mar-26
The ADP jobs report for February headlined at +63K and a steady +4.5% annual pay figure. The weekly data from ADP had been strengthening over the past month, but this is still well above forecasts below 50K. However, the revision cut the already weak January headline in half, and most of the gains were in healthcare and education for small businesses. This service sees temporary stabilization in a frozen labor market that is still at the beginning of a long term trend where companies are attempting to use increasingly focused AI to juice profitability by reducing low-skill jobs that don't currently involve hands on physical work. However, over the medium to long term, the spread through manufacturing and then other industries should accelerate as automation increases, and this is likely to be seen in retrospect as the one of the early plateaus in a long series of labor market step downs for the American labor market.
Next week's data would normally be dominated by CPI & PCE on Wednesday & Friday mornings, but unless there is some credible sign of a speedy resolution to the Middle East war, markets are likely to look past benign figures. Otherwise, energy led inflation will be a concern.
